- Uninstall zomboid,
- delete 'steamapps/common/Project Zomboid' to get rid of leftover / unwanted files from mods,
- reinstall zomboid,
This ensures you're starting with a clean slate -- you might need to slowly re-enable your mods bit by bit to see which ones cause issue.
Any issues with specific mods should be addressed to the mod author on the workshop page so they're aware of the issues 🍻

hey real quick how can i figure out which mods are causing conflicts from the logs?
mind the ping but im hoping to save a bit on now and future hassle but unsure about how to decode the logs
Mods generally cause issues with vanilla functions, so most of the time the logs wont be too helpful in figuring out what mods cause issues
Therefore its best to just test removing them
Beard raises a good point that it’s not ALWAYS clear where the monkey wrench is being thrown, but looking for “Stack Trace” or “exception” can usually point you in the right direction.
